Arsenal face a tough test on Sunday as they take on Newcastle United at St James's Park in what is possibly the toughest of their remaining league fixtures.

The Gunners retook first place with 3-1 a win against Chelsea on Tuesday before Man City responded with a 3-0 win at home against West Ham to retake top spot. The title race is out of the Gunners' hands, but they know any slip ups for treble chasing City could open the door for an unlikely title win.

Newcastle, meanwhile, are in a strong position in third place, with little chance of being caught from teams outside the top four, but will want to keep pushing to avoid being caught by fourth placed Man United. The Magpies have eight wins in their last nine matches and have lost once at home this season, topping the form table for the last three matches with 13 goals scored.

This presents a formidable test for Arsenal in their quest to win for a second successive match. They lost at St James's Park last May, however, with a 2-0 defeat to Howe's side dealing a huge blow to their chances of Champions League qualification that season, before a draw at the Emirates this season.

When is Newcastle vs Arsenal?

The match takes place at St James's Park in Newcastle on Sunday, 7 May and kicks off at 4:30pm (BST).

How to watch Newcastle vs Arsenal:

The match will be broadcast live as part of Sky Sports' Super Sunday coverage on Sky Sports Main Event and Sky Sports Premier League.

Team news:

Newcastle could welcome back Sean Longstaff and Allan St Maximin for the match, with the pair having suffered short-term setbacks last month. However, they remain without Emil Krafth and club captain Jamal Lascelles has been ruled out for the rest of the season.

Arsenal, meanwhile, should have Gabriel Maghalles back for the match after he limped off against Chelsea on Tuesday. However, they will expect to be without the injured William Saliba, who may return before the end of the season but not this weekend. Meanwhile, there are still long-term absentees in the form of Mohamed Elneny and Takehiro Tomiyasu.
